Associate Manager, Planning & Business Operations

United States

About The Role:

Little Spoon was founded on the belief that today's parents are different — equal parts more time-strapped and more food-savvy than ever before. We set out to disrupt a century-old category with products and an experience that deliver on what the modern parent deserves.

As an Associate Manager, Planning & Business Operations, you will provide tactical project management support across our product portfolio, ensuring cross-functional teams stay aligned, timelines are maintained and work moves forward with clarity and momentum. This role is an important part of the connective tissue that keeps our innovation pipeline running smoothly, from a product's first brief through to launch, renovation and discontinuation. We're looking for someone who has operated inside a CPG Project Management Office (PMO) or formal project management function, ideally within food and beverage, and who understands the pace and rhythm of physical product development.

What You'll Do:

Planning and Business Operations

  • Coordinate project stakeholders, timelines and key milestones across a portfolio of concurrent initiatives, ensuring alignment across teams.
  • Track project progress against critical paths, proactively flagging risks, blockers and overdue tasks to relevant owners.
  • Maintain and update project tracking tools and dashboards, ensuring they reflect accurate, up-to-date status at all times.
  • Follow up with cross-functional partners on outstanding action items and inputs, keeping work moving between formal meetings.
  • Prepare for and facilitate  recurring cross-functional meetings, including agenda development, note-taking and next step distribution
  • Develop, test, and refine AI solutions (i.e. skills + projects on Claude) to scale the team’s work and leverage across the business

End-to-End Product Portfolio Project Management

  • Support the project management of product launches, renovations and discontinuations across the portfolio, ensuring timelines are built, maintained and communicated clearly.
  • Build and maintain project timelines in Monday.com based on brief inputs, project type and launch channel.
  • Monitor and maintain the Portfolio Change Management project portfolio, keeping the status of active SKU renovations, label changes and discontinuations current and visible.
  • Coordinate cross-functional inputs for brief reviews and portfolio alignment meetings, following up on missing information ahead of deadlines.
  • Maintain sources of truth across the portfolio, including SKU lists, discontinuation trackers and at-risk and out-of-stock processes.
  • Support the maintenance and continuous improvement of Airtable bases and Monday.com boards, identifying opportunities to reduce manual effort through automation or tooling improvements.

What You'll Bring:

  • High organization and attention to detail, with the ability to manage multiple workstreams simultaneously
  • A proactive communication style — consistent follow-through, closed loops and momentum between formal touchpoints
  • Ownership of your work, good judgment about when to ask questions and a clear sense of when to escalate
  • You are a self-starter, and ask thoughtful and specific questions to show a basic understanding mindset of doing some research first
  • A service mindset and genuine energy for supporting a high-performing team

What You'll Need:

  • 3+ years of experience in a CPG Project Management Office (PMO) or formal project management function, with a strong preference for candidates coming from food and beverage or other perishable/short shelf-life product categories
  • Hands-on experience with project management tools such as Monday.com, Airtable or similar platforms
  • Curiosity and comfort experimenting with modern AI tools to enhance project management efficiency 
  • Strong written communication skills, with an ability to produce clear, organized recaps and follow-ups
  • Comfort working in fast-paced environments with competing priorities and evolving scope

How You'll Stand Out:

  • Direct experience in a food and beverage or perishable CPG environment, with exposure to shelf-life constraints, ingredient sourcing timelines, or manufacturing/co-man coordination
  • Familiarity with product launch or innovation processes, including working alongside R&D, marketing, operations or supply chain teams
  • Experience building or maintaining Airtable bases, Monday.com boards, AI skills + projects, or similar tooling workflows and automations

About Little Spoon

Little Spoon is the fastest growing baby and kids food brand in the United States. On a mission to make parents’ lives easier and kids healthier, we are bringing the future of kids food to the modern parent through a first-of-its-kind platform of products delivered straight to your door. Little Spoon sets your child up for a lifetime of health, from a baby’s very first bites through to their big kid years, with a portfolio of freshly-made baby food, early finger foods, toddler, big kid meals and snacks. Since launch, the company has delivered more than 60 million meals and is responsible for feeding more than 2.9% of US babies, helping to simplify the lives of hundreds of thousands of parents. Benefits

At Little Spoon, we believe taking care of our team is just as important as taking care of our customers.
Here’s what you can expect when you join the Spooniverse:

🥄 Equity
Every Spooner shares in our success. All full-time salaried employees are granted stock options as part of their total compensation.

🩵 Comprehensive Health Coverage
We offer medical, dental, and vision plans with a variety of options to fit your needs.

💸 401(k) with Company Match
We match 100% of your contributions up to 5% of your salary — with no waiting period.

🌴 Flexible PTO + Holidays
In addition to 11  company holidays, we offer flexible paid time off (no set cap) for full-time employees.

👶 Paid Parental Leave
We’re proud to support new parents with at least 12 weeks of paid leave (and up to 18 weeks for birthing parents). Available after 6 months of full-time employment.

📖 Learning & Development
$250 per quarter to invest in your growth — whether that’s coaching, courses, or your next great read.

🍌 Little Spoon Perks
$200 Welcome to the Team credit
50% off recurring code for your own account
20% off recurring code to share with close friends & family

Little Spoon is home to extraordinary, mission-aligned people, and we aim to compensate accordingly. Compensation is informed by market data, company stage, the scope of the role, location, and individual experience. The anticipated base salary range for NYC-based candidates is $85,000 - $100,000 USD, commensurate with experience. Candidates outside of NYC or in remote roles may be subject to a different range. This role also includes an equity package and comprehensive benefits designed to support the well-being and growth of every Spooner.
